_aIn the early chapters of this book, reference was made to Psalms 95 and the number of "LET US" phrases used by the Psalmist. One of the encouragements in this book is to have the reader personalize the key phrase. In place of "LET US", one should personalize the phrase to be "LET ME." Why should this be done? Because, the Scriptures principally teach what one is to believe concerning God and the duty God requires of each one. This is why "LET US/LET ME" is not a suggestion but a direction for one to live by. It is a mandate for one's life and ultimate happiness in the Lord. We learn that there many uses of the phrase "LET US" in scripture and that this is not a suggestion but a directive. We are challenged to become spiritually mature Christians by following these directives so that we may withstand the many challenges that come our way as ambassadors of Christ.
